Water management and circular economy

Water is one of our most valuable resources, and we consciously use it sparingly. By combining straw with adapted irrigation techniques, we minimize water consumption. At the same time, we combine fruit growing and arable farming in a closed cycle: The straw from wheat cultivation is used for our strawberry rows.

Different pillars, one clear vision

Contrary to the trend toward specialization, we consciously focus on diversity. Strawberry cultivation has become one of our most important business areas, complemented by the vineyard we planted in 2008. With our vacation apartments, we have also oriented ourselves toward tourism and direct marketing. Arable farming, which supports crop rotation and keeps our strawberry plantations healthy, is a matter close to the heart of senior partner Wolfgang Engel.

A turbulent past – shaped by history

Our farm has a long and eventful history:

  • The early years: Malkwitz, the town where our farm is located, was first mentioned in 1215. The history of our farm began in 1868, when Mr. Blunck built the neoclassical house.
  • Strokes of fate and reconstruction: On the night of June 19-20, 1899, a fire destroyed two large barns. In 1923, the then owner, August Schröder, added another storey to the house and renamed the farm "Ingenhof" in honor of his wife.
  • A new beginning for the Engel family: In 1950, Oskar Engel began working at Ingenhof and led the business with his family through a period of great change. After another fire in 1968, the farm buildings were rebuilt on the original foundations.
